Cancer dissemination and metastasis are important prognosis factors in Non-small cell lung cancer,its major reason belongs to new angiogenesis and lymphangiogenesis . Vascular endothelial growth factor-C(VEGF-C),a novel VEGF member ,has been proved an important lymphangiogenesis factor.When it binds to its respectors VEGFR-2 and VEGFR-3, they will activate lymphangiogenesis,which makes a good chance for lymph node metastasis in tumor. VEGFR-3, a receptor tyrosine kinase of VEGF receptors family, is so far the first specific antigenic marker for the lymphatic endothelium and expresses almost only in lymphatic endothelium cell.Recently,with more and more specific lymphatic endothelium marker to be found, lymphangiogenesis has become been a research hotspot of tumor metastasis.Currently,some study have shown that there are some relation between lymphangiogenesis and clinical characteristics in colorectal cancer, breast cancer, esophageal cancer and so on.But few study is finished about this field in Non-small cell lung cancer.Objective: To investigate relation between correlated protein expressions of lymphangiogenesis and clinical characteristics and prognosis of Non-small cell lung cancer,and study further mechanism of lymph node metastasis in tumor,and hope to find a new way for tumor therapy.Method: A total 58 cases of NSCLC patients with detail clinical complete postoperative follow-up records and 36 cases of normal lung tissues in West China Hospital of Sichuan University from January 1,2001 to December 31,2001 are enrolled in this study. The expressions of VEGF-C and VEGFR-3 were detected in 58 paraffin sections of NSCLC and 36 cases of normal lung tissues by immunohistochemistry(LsAB). Lymphtic vessel density(LVD) were counted.All datas were analysed by SPSS 13.0.Results: 1.The positive expression rate of VEGF-C in 58 cases of NSCLC was 65.5%. VEGF-C expression was nagatively associated with the degree of differentiation of tumor cell and more frequently found in tumors with lymph node metastasis than in those without it. The peritumoral LVD in VEGF-C positive expression group was signifinantly higher than in VEGF-C negative expression group,but there was no difference in intratumoral LVD between two groups. The study showed positive correlation between VEGF-C expression with peritumoral LVD and lymph node metastasis,and negative correlation with the degree of differentiation of tumor cell.2. The LVD in peritumoral tissues was signifinantly higher than that in intratumoral tissue and normal lung tissues,but there was no signifinant difference between intratumoral tissues and normal lung tissues. Peritumoral LVD of NSCLC tissues in lymph node metastasis group,VEGF-C positive expression group,stage III and IV group was signifinantly higher than no lymph node metastasis group,VEGF-C nagetive expression group,stage I and II group. There was no signifinant correlation between intratumoral LVD and each clinical characteristic of NSCLC.3. According to survival analysis, VEGF-C positive expression and high peritumoral LVD were nagetively correlated with five-years survival rate of patients.From multivariate analysis, VEGF-C expression in cancer cell and peritumoral LVD in NSCLC tissues were retained signifmantly nagetive prognotic impact on overall survival.Conclusion: 1.There was overexpression of VEGF-C in NSCLC. Peritumoral LVD and lymph node metastasis of VEGF-C positive expression group was signifmantly higher than VEGF-C negative expression group, which was possibly disclosed that VEGF-C expression correlated with high peritumoral LVD and lynph node metastasis in NSCLC.2. Peritumoral LVD is signifinantly higher than intratumoral LVD in NSCLC,which indicated that high peritumoral LVD was an important impact on lymph node metastasis in NSCLC.3. VEGF-C positive expression and high peritumoral LVD in NSCLC cound be useful predictors of poor prognosis in NSCLC.
